179 New Coronavirus Cases Reported in Afghanistan, Total 2,469

2nd May, 2020 · admin

Wahidullah Mayar

Tolo News: The Ministry of Public Health spokesman Wahidullah Mayar said on Saturday that in the past 24 hours, 179 positive cases have been recorded across the country, and the country total is 2,469. The number of reported recoveries in the country is 331, while 72 have died. Click here to read more (external link).
